How To Fix CN323 - Monitoring dates saved


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CN - Meldungen für Netzpläne

  • Message number: 323

  • Message text: Monitoring dates saved

    The SAP error message CN323, which states "Monitoring dates saved," typically occurs in the context of project management and controlling within SAP, particularly when dealing with network activities in the Project System (PS) module. This message indicates that the monitoring dates for a network or activity have been saved, but it may also imply that there are issues related to the dates that need to be addressed.

    Cause:

    1. Date Conflicts: The error may arise due to conflicts between the planned dates and the actual dates of activities or milestones.
    2. Incomplete Data: Required fields or data may be missing, leading to issues when trying to save or update monitoring dates.
    3. Status Issues: The status of the project or network may not allow for changes to be made to the monitoring dates.
    4.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ary permissions to modify the monitoring dates.

    Solution:

    1. Check Dates: Review the planned and actual dates for the network or activity to ensure there are no conflicts. Make sure that the dates are logically consistent.
    2. Complete Required Fields: Ensure that all mandatory fields are filled out correctly before saving the monitoring dates.
    3. Review Project Status: Check the status of the project or network. If it is locked or in a status that does not allow changes, you may need to change the status or consult with a project manager.
    4. Authorization Check: Verify that you have the necessary authorizations to make changes to the monitoring dates. If not, contact your SAP administrator to obtain the required permissions.
